Ombu Location

Ombu is located at Sequoia Hotel, 91 - 93 Mother Ignacia Avenue, Quezon City, Luzon Philippines. This is a International restaurant near the Manila.The average price range at Ombu is around ₱ 400 / Person,and the opening hours are 8:00 - 18:00.Ombu is a well-known gourmet restaurant in the Manila area. There are different kinds of food in Ombu that are worth trying. If you have any questions,please contact +63 2 921 7469.

    Ombu is a small restaurant helping Pilipino dishes. My close friends and I ate merienda and lunch time there while chatting and exchanging tales. We'd champorado with tuyo, Mediterranean salad and poultry arrozcaldo for merienda and herb crusted mahi mahi, Pinoy salad, laing and crispyspare ribs for lunch time. These were well-prepared with new ingredients and savory taste. Service is fairly fast, however the price is really a bit high in comparison with a nearby eating place offering Pilipino dishes as well. Overall though, I liked the food.

    I actually had my breakfast in this cafe for 5 times. The buffet is really a regular Filipino breakfast. It really is good. Not really that a lot of selections. They're changing their menu daily. In order to benefit from its breakfast buffet, it just cost 250pesos or around 5 bucks. I acquired mine free, since it had been complimentary breakfast from Sequoia Resort.
